Transaction 34a0c7cc98faefa5b705c03d1ce92999558536305ee5c879889e81efdbb38d23

1 Input
2 Outputs
  • 34a0c7cc98faefa5b705c03d1ce92999558536305ee5c879889e81efdbb38d23:0
  • value  447652
    address  3Ls5UAkME4EJonJAJyumYpfdRwbgoeEfFw
  • 34a0c7cc98faefa5b705c03d1ce92999558536305ee5c879889e81efdbb38d23:1
  • value  26845997
    address  1742LEyFfHNfjoCLQqEmtRbP7derNUrE7u